/* |
|
* linux/arch/m68k/sun3/sun3ints.c -- Sun-3(x) Linux interrupt handling code |
|
* |
|
* This file is subject to the terms and conditions of the GNU General Public |
|
* License. See the file COPYING in the main directory of this archive |
|
* for more details. |
|
*/ |
|
|
|
#include <linux/types.h> |
|
#include <linux/kernel.h> |
|
#include <linux/sched.h> |
|
#include <linux/kernel_stat.h> |
|
#include <linux/interrupt.h> |
|
#include <asm/segment.h> |
|
#include <asm/intersil.h> |
|
#include <asm/oplib.h> |
|
#include <asm/sun3ints.h> |
|
#include <asm/irq_regs.h> |
|
#include <linux/seq_file.h> |
|
|
|
extern void sun3_leds (unsigned char); |
|
|
|
void sun3_disable_interrupts(void) |
|
{ |
|
sun3_disable_irq(0); |
|
} |
|
|
|
void sun3_enable_interrupts(void) |
|
{ |
|
sun3_enable_irq(0); |
|
} |
|
|
|
static int led_pattern[8] = { |
|
~(0x80), ~(0x01), |
|
~(0x40), ~(0x02), |
|
~(0x20), ~(0x04), |
|
~(0x10), ~(0x08) |
|
}; |
|
|
|
volatile unsigned char* sun3_intreg; |
|
|
|
void sun3_enable_irq(unsigned int irq) |
|
{ |
|
*sun3_intreg |= (1 << irq); |
|
} |
|
|
|
void sun3_disable_irq(unsigned int irq) |
|
{ |
|
*sun3_intreg &= ~(1 << irq); |
|
} |
|
|
|
static irqreturn_t sun3_int7(int irq, void *dev_id) |
|
{ |
|
unsigned int cnt; |
|
|
|
cnt = kstat_irqs_cpu(irq, 0); |
|
if (!(cnt % 2000)) |
|
sun3_leds(led_pattern[cnt % 16000 / 2000]); |
|
return IRQ_HANDLED; |
|
} |
|
|
|
static irqreturn_t sun3_int5(int irq, void *dev_id) |
|
{ |
|
unsigned long flags; |
|
unsigned int cnt; |
|
|
|
local_irq_save(flags); |
|
#ifdef CONFIG_SUN3 |
|
intersil_clear(); |
|
#endif |
|
sun3_disable_irq(5); |
|
sun3_enable_irq(5); |
|
#ifdef CONFIG_SUN3 |
|
intersil_clear(); |
|
#endif |
|
legacy_timer_tick(1); |
|
cnt = kstat_irqs_cpu(irq, 0); |
|
if (!(cnt % 20)) |
|
sun3_leds(led_pattern[cnt % 160 / 20]); |
|
local_irq_restore(flags); |
|
return IRQ_HANDLED; |
|
} |
|
|
|
static irqreturn_t sun3_vec255(int irq, void *dev_id) |
|
{ |
|
return IRQ_HANDLED; |
|
} |
|
|
|
void __init sun3_init_IRQ(void) |
|
{ |
|
*sun3_intreg = 1; |
|
|
|
m68k_setup_user_interrupt(VEC_USER, 128); |
|
|
|
if (request_irq(IRQ_AUTO_5, sun3_int5, 0, "clock", NULL)) |
|
pr_err("Couldn't register %s interrupt\n", "int5"); |
|
if (request_irq(IRQ_AUTO_7, sun3_int7, 0, "nmi", NULL)) |
|
pr_err("Couldn't register %s interrupt\n", "int7"); |
|
if (request_irq(IRQ_USER+127, sun3_vec255, 0, "vec255", NULL)) |
|
pr_err("Couldn't register %s interrupt\n", "vec255"); |
|
}
